The 23-year-old striker is a guarantee of FPL points when fit and firing. He has claimed Golden Boots in each of his two seasons at the Etihad Stadium. Across those campaigns, Haaland has registered 63 top-flight goals through 66 appearances.

Haaland will remain a favourite for fantasy bosses in 2024-25, but the Norway international will not come cheap. It has been revealed that the prolific frontman comes with a £15 million price tag – becoming the first player to hit that mark.

Prior to the current asking price reveal, Haaland had sat level with Manchester United great Ronaldo (2008-09) and Arsenal legend Henry (2006-07) with a top price of £14m. Ex-Gunners and Red Devils forward Robin van Persie also demanded that fee in 2013-14.

Haaland now stands alone at the top of that chart, with the FPL revealing how much Premier League icons will cost in the new campaign. City will be hoping to see their No.9 hit the ground running when opening the defence of their title away at Chelsea on August 18.
